Dungarvin is seeking experienced Direct Support Professionals (DSPs) to join their Day Program. If you’ve worked in caregiving, education, behavioral health, or another human services role, your experience is valuable here. As a DSP, you will coach and foster engagement by leading workshops designed to support individuals with developmental disabilities. DSPs act as life coaches - mentoring and continuously engaging individuals while leading groups through activities like art, music, games, audio/visual, cooking, reading, and other life enrichment opportunities. You will also provide direct care support, behavioral interventions, and ensure timely and accurate documentation of daily progress. Dungarvin has been committed to person-centered care for over 45 years, empowering individuals with disabilities to live fulfilling lives. The company is dedicated to fostering an inclusive, collaborative environment for its employees and the individuals they serve.
